How Do Emulsifiers Function?



Exactly how do emulsifiers develop secure mixtures from two typically unmixable fluids? Emulsifiers work by lowering the surface area tension between oil and water, which are inherently incompatible as a result of their molecular structures. They have both hydrophilic (water-attracting) and hydrophobic (water-repelling) residential or commercial properties, enabling them to interact with both phases. When an emulsifier is presented to a mixture of oil and water, its molecules position themselves at the user interface, with the hydrophilic end in the water and the hydrophobic end in the oil. This plan maintains the solution by avoiding the oil droplets from integrating and separating from the water stage. The outcome is a consistent mix, recognized as a solution, which can be either oil-in-water or water-in-oil, relying on the predominant phase. Because of this, emulsifiers play a vital function in numerous products, guaranteeing uniformity and stability in formulations varying from food things to cosmetics.


Types of Emulsifiers in Food Products



In the domain of food manufacturing, numerous sorts of emulsifiers are employed to improve texture, security, and overall top quality. These emulsifiers can be classified largely right into natural and synthetic types. All-natural emulsifiers, such as lecithin, stemmed from soybeans or egg yolks, are generally utilized in products like mayo and chocolates. They are preferred for their tidy label appeal and functional benefits.


Synthetic emulsifiers, like mono- and diglycerides, are often utilized in processed foods for their cost-effectiveness and versatility. These compounds help keep the preferred uniformity in products such as margarine and salad dressings. In addition, polysorbates, an additional classification of synthetic emulsifiers, boost the security of emulsions in gelato and sauces. Each sort of emulsifier plays a necessary function in making certain the desired sensory qualities and shelf-life of foodstuff, eventually improving the customer experience.

Usual Emulsifiers and Their Resources

A variety of emulsifiers are made use of across different industries, they can normally be categorized right into all-natural and synthetic resources. emulsifiers. Natural emulsifiers consist of lecithin, originated from soybeans or egg yolks, and casein, a protein discovered in milk. These materials are commonly favored for their wellness advantages and minimal processing. Other all-natural emulsifiers, such as periodontal Arabic and pectin, are extracted from plants and fruits, providing a clean label appeal in food products


In contrast, artificial emulsifiers like mono- and diglycerides are originated from glycerol and fatty acids. These emulsifiers are generally utilized in refined foods for their efficiency and cost-efficiency. Polysorbates, an additional synthetic alternative, are widely employed in various applications, consisting of cosmetics and pharmaceuticals. Each kind of emulsifier offers certain practical duties, ensuring stability and consistency in the formulations of daily products.
